What is a Self-Emptying Robot Vacuum?
A self-emptying robot vacuum is a smart appliance designed to handle the strenuous job of cleaning flooring surface areas while also autonomously disposing of collected dust, dirt, and particles. Unlike standard robot vacuums that require regular manual emptying, self-emptying models include a base station that collects the waste from the vacuum, enabling it to recharge and continue cleaning without consistent human intervention.

Self-emptying robot vacuums use several advantages over conventional cleaning techniques and even basic robot vacuums. Here are some of the main benefits:

Convenience: With self-emptying abilities, users can delight in weeks of maintenance-free cleaning without requiring to manually deal with dirt and particles.

Performance: These vacuums are typically equipped with advanced navigation innovations that allow them to tidy larger areas better, consisting of hard-to-reach corners.

Time-saving: By automating the vacuuming procedure, people can spend their time on more satisfying activities, minimizing their overall home chores.

Improved Air Quality: Regular cleaning with these vacuums can add to much better air quality in the home by constantly getting rid of animal dander, dust, and irritants.

Smart Features: Many designs come equipped with smart technology, allowing users to set up cleanings, display performance, and get alerts through their smartphones.

While self-emptying robot vacuums can be a substantial financial investment, they are not without their downsides. Here are some considerations prospective buyers must remember:

Initial Cost: These advanced models often include a greater price compared to basic robot vacuums.

Upkeep: While they are low-maintenance, users still need to clean the base station from time to time to ensure ideal efficiency.

Sound Level: Some designs might produce noise throughout operation or emptying cycles, which could be disruptive in peaceful environments.

Size and Design: The base station takes up space, so buyers need to make sure there suffices room for it.

Pet Compatibility: While many models are developed with animal owners in mind, not all are equally reliable at handling pet hair and bigger debris.
